Today, we stand together to honor and support the countless LGBTQIA+ individuals who face discrimination, violence, and persecution simply for being who they are.

May 17th marks the International Day Against Homophobia, Biphobia, and Transphobia (IDAHOBIT), a day dedicated to raising awareness about the struggles faced by the LGBTQIA+ community worldwide. 

Homophobia, biphobia, and transphobia are not just individual cases of intolerance, they are systemic issues embedded in laws, cultures, and societal norms across the world.

For LGBTQIA+ refugees, this means facing life-threatening situations, forced displacement, and immense challenges in seeking asylum and rebuilding their lives from the ground up.

We, at FUR/HELP, are committed to providing safe havens and vital support for post-soviet LGBTQIA+ refugees that are a part of Furry community fleeing from persecution and American Trans lives that flee the danger to their lives. Our mission is to ensure that every individual has the right to live freely, authentically, and without fear. 
 
We honor their resilience and pledge to fight for a world where everyone can live with dignity, pride and respect.

Together, we strive to create a future where love and acceptance triumph over hate and intolerance.
